In the era of road rehabilitation and green construction, the recycling and reuse of reclaimed asphalt pavement (RAP) has become a core industry trend. However, traditional crushing equipment often relies on “brute force impact,” which easily fractures the hard aggregates within the milling material. This not only generates excessive dust but also damages the original aggregate gradation, significantly compromising the performance of recycled asphalt mixtures.

Flexible Shearing Technology Preserves Aggregate Gradation
The Huashengming double-tooth roll crusher abandons traditional impact crushing in favor of a low-speed, high-torque “shearing + tensile + squeezing” principle. This gentle, “kneading” crushing force precisely separates asphalt agglomerates at their bonding points, preserving the original particle size distribution, angularity, and surface texture of the aggregates. This approach not only prevents over-crushing but also ensures that the recycled material possesses excellent mechanical properties, fully meeting the construction requirements of high-grade asphalt pavements.

Intelligent Hydraulic Protection Ensures Continuous, Efficient Production
Road milling material often contains tramp metal such as iron pieces and rebar. The Huashengming double-tooth roll crusher is equipped with an advanced hydraulic automatic release system and dual overload protection. When encountering hard objects, the rollers automatically retract to increase the gap, expel the foreign material, and then reset automatically—completely eliminating jamming and spindle seizure. Combined with an intelligent PLC control system, the equipment can operate unattended, significantly reducing labor costs and ensuring 24/7 continuous, stable production.
